#asktheexpert what is the remedy for heat boil?

A. skin infections like boils folliculitis, furuncles, and carbuncles are caused by bacteria. risk factors: - anyone can be affected. - children with weak immune systems are more vulnerable if occurring again and again. - close contact with infected individuals, skin injuries, and exposure to certain environments play a role. symptoms: - red, warm, swollen, and painful skin lesions. - lesions may discharge pus. - fever, chills, and increased heart rate may occur. treatment:x - mild cases may resolve without treatment. - moderate to severe cases may require incision, drainage, and antibiotics. - seek medical advice if multiple skinf boils are suspected in a child.
